Server uses positional data, if you disconnect , server no longer gets your position, yet CV is moving with other players in it, should never disconnect from a moving ship.
If its just dinner, say an hour, feed the character and let him sit in passenger chair , he will consume at a slow rate and lasts around an hour like that before hunger is an issue, assuming CV has air.
Or agree with mates, CV doesnt move when one of you is not online.
Always keep a tiny cheap SV ready to spawn from BP, and always carry fuel cells on the character.
Just an idea: Make a "cryo chamber" or something like that - known from other survival games in space.. So when "one" disconnects from the server, he has to enter the cryo chamber. That cryo chamber is then locked to that person only. So a cryo chamber can only hold one person. That should prevent spawning on top of another player etc, as it would happen, if "one" just was in the chair when disconnecting, and someone else is sitting in the chair when connecting.......
